‘Urgenciologist’, a specialty in emergency medicine as a future guarantee against a pandemic like that of coronavirus

It is a recurring claim by the group of emergency medicine and nursing; an own specialty, that of “emergency doctor” They assure that it would be a guarantee of future for them and also for society in general. In addition, it must be remembered that in all the countries of Europe it exists, except in Cyprus, Portugal and Spain. And, curiously, in Spain, it does exist within the military medical regime.

Tato Vázquez Lima, Vice President of the Spanish Society of Emergency Medicine (SEMES), reveals a claim that comes from behind, but that becomes more current with the health crisis we are experiencing. In addition to a guarantee of future for the professionals of this key service in the pandemic, it would also be “a lever for its organization, structure and final homogenization, and an impetus for its training and research work,” he says.

It exists in the military medical regime, but not in the civilian

The situation has less explanation, if possible, if we take a look at the military medicine. The Official State Gazette (BOE) has released this week the first MIRs who have chosen the specialty of emergencies in the military field, since here it is approved. For this group this differentiation between the civil and the military is an inconsistency.

The vice president of SEMES, and president of the Company in Galicia, also recalls that approval in this area was approved in Congress and in the Senate without any vote against. “We believe that the creation of the specialty of emergency medicine as it exists throughout Europe, in the western world and in Latin American countries is timely. It would also be consistent with the PNL (non-law proposal) approved in 2018 in the Congress of Deputies and with the motion approved in the Senate in the same year, and also recommended by the report of the Ombudsmen of the year 2015 ”.

At the forefront of the coronavirus pandemic

A group, the one of urgencies and emergencies, that has had a fundamental work against the coronavirus pandemic. They are the first to receive and manage suspected coronavirus cases, are those who face the initial assessment of changing symptoms and those who have a fundamental role in the early care of these cases, as well as their classification and care in the first hours. They have been key since the beginning of this coronavirus health crisis.
